Boss fights in video games are notorious for their complexity and challenge, and *The First Berserker: Khazan* is no exception. The Blade Phantom, a formidable adversary encountered on the Trials of the Frozen Mountain level on Stormpass, is a multi-phase battle that will test your ability to manage stamina and aggression. Here's a detailed guide on how to conquer the Blade Phantom in *The First Berserker: Khazan*.
Phase 1
The haunting ghostly voices of Khazan manifest into the Blade Phantom, a relentless foe that challenges your combat skills. The battle begins in a castle with floors covered in a crimson liquid, setting a tense atmosphere. The Blade Phantom's arsenal includes:
- A six-hit combo featuring four punches and two kicks, with the second kick delayed for added difficulty.
- A three-hit combo of two punches followed by a downward kick.
- A four-hit combo starting with a right hook, followed by two kicks, and concluding with a leaping kick smash.
- A three-hit combo with flashing punches and a grab that you must dodge.
Beyond these melee attacks, the Blade Phantom can summon a giant hammer, causing damage and spawning red spikes. If it opts for a spear, be prepared for a quick throw and a subsequent teleporting smash. When wielding a blade, expect a swift six-hit combo. The boss can also vanish and dash around the battlefield before launching an attack.
Mastering the timing of these attacks is crucial. Parry or dodge to create openings for your own attacks, depleting the Blade Phantom's stamina to execute a Brutal Attack. Continue this strategy until you reduce its health by about half, triggering the second phase.

Phase 2
In the second phase, the Blade Phantom initiates with four claw attacks, followed by a spear throw from above. Evade the spear's impact zone and brace for a leaping swipe. This is followed by three greatsword slashes and a final hammer smash.
While retaining most of its previous moves, the Blade Phantom introduces new claw attacks, a spear thrust with a follow-up, and swift dual-wielding attacks ranging from four to six hits. The boss increases its teleportation frequency, and when wielding the greatsword, be alert for multiple slashes and the decisive Burst Attack signaled by a red P-like symbol on the screen. Counterattack (L1/LB + Circle/B) is essential to parry this attack, restoring your stamina and leaving the boss vulnerable.
Strategically attack when the Blade Phantom's stamina is low, and only initiate the Brutal Attack when the window is nearly closed to maximize damage. Upon defeating the Blade Phantom, you'll earn 8,640 Lacrima, Soul Eater gear items, a Shieldsman’s Ring, and Netherworld Mineral for crafting.
